<div class="filter-group"> <label>đź“… Decade</label> <select id="decadeFilter"> <option value="all">All</option> <option value="1980">80s</option> <option value="1990">90s</option> <option value="2000">2000s</option> <option value="2010">2010s</option> <option value="2020">2020+</option> </select> </div>
.no-results text-align: center; grid-column: 1 / -1; padding: 3rem;
function renderGrid() const grid = document.getElementById('movieGrid'); const toShow = currentFiltered.slice(0, visibleCount); if (toShow.length === 0) grid.innerHTML = <div class="no-results">🎞️ No movies match. Try different filters!</div> ; return;
<div class="filter-group"> <label>đź“… Decade</label> <select id="decadeFilter"> <option value="all">All</option> <option value="1980">80s</option> <option value="1990">90s</option> <option value="2000">2000s</option> <option value="2010">2010s</option> <option value="2020">2020+</option> </select> </div>
.no-results text-align: center; grid-column: 1 / -1; padding: 3rem;
function renderGrid() const grid = document.getElementById('movieGrid'); const toShow = currentFiltered.slice(0, visibleCount); if (toShow.length === 0) grid.innerHTML = <div class="no-results">🎞️ No movies match. Try different filters!</div> ; return;

%!s(int=2026) © %!d(string=Northern Leaf).P.A. - P.IVA 08856650968